Barrons quintet here with Anne Drummond on alto and flute, drummer Kim Thompson,
Kiyoshi Kitagawa on bass, and vibraphonist Stefon Harris is a powerhouse of
lyrical and percussive counterpoint and exotic voices. One listen to Barrons
Jasmine Flower, with its Eastern melody and exceptional interplay between the
pianist and Harris vibes that is knotty but never jagged, is enough to convince.
Elsewhere, as on Harris The Lost Ones, where Barrons middle register ostinati
are given free rein to punctuate the skeletal melody and warm texture of the
tunes body, is so elegant its moving. The lilting flute line played by Drummond,
just ahead of the impressionistic beat and highlighted by the vibes, makes this
an amiable yet compelling listen. This is followed with a wonderfully
light-touched read of Bud Powells Hallucinations. Barrons touch is breezy and
effective; he gets to the complex lyric fragments in the center of the structure
and trots them out for the bands interaction. Harris solo has just the right
tautness to keep it grounded and pulsing. The reading of Wayne Shorters
Footprints extrapolates the Latin melody from the tunes heart and makes it a
rhythmic construct with Barron and Harris winding around Kitagawa in an easy but
swirling pace to the top of the figure and then into the maelstrom of the solo
exchanges. In sum, this is another fine date by a pianist who seems to
restlessly climb another rung with every outing even though he has been at the
top of his game for decades.~Thom Jurek
